Description
DLGAP4 encodes a member of the DLGAP (discs large-associated protein) family, which interacts with PSD-95 and other MAGUK proteins at postsynaptic densities. The protein is involved in synaptic organization and plasticity, and variants have been associated with neurodevelopmental disorders including schizophrenia and autism spectrum disorder.

Protein Summary
DLGAP4 is a 960-amino acid protein containing multiple ankyrin repeats and a C-terminal PDZ-binding motif. It localizes to postsynaptic densities and scaffolds signaling complexes involving PSD-95, NMDA receptors, and cytoskeletal elements. Alternative splicing generates isoforms with distinct expression patterns.
